site stats

Rebased_addr

WebbIt combines both static and dynamic symbolic ("concolic") analysis, making it applicable to a variety of tasks." And the very interesting task we are going to use it for here is static … Webb6 sep. 2024 · This is what is shown in the print output. >>> malloc.rebased_addr 0x1054400 # .linked_addr is its address relative to the prelinked base of the binary. This …

Python angr.Project方法代码示例 - 纯净天空

Webbrebased_addr = lambda x: proj.loader.find_symbol (x).rebased_addr 使用例) find, avoid = [], [] find += [rebased_addr ('check_passed')] 相対アドレスを得る ディスアセンブラで表 … WebbTo use the call state, you should call it with .call_state(addr, arg1, arg2, ...), where addr is the address of the function you want to call and argN is the Nth argument to that … jobs at chubb insurance company https://jocatling.com

Python Examples of angr.SIM_PROCEDURES - ProgramCreek.com

Webb14 jan. 2024 · 概述. 二进制研究的很多应用都离不开二进制的静态分析。. 比如符号执行、模糊测试等技术可以利用静态分析的结果用来进行进一步的优化。. angr内部实现了很多静 … Webb25 apr. 2024 · x /20xg addr 查 64 位程序内存信息. x /20xw addr 查 32 位程序内存信息 [/collapse] 查看调用中的堆栈. where:显示调用堆栈; frame:显示调用堆栈顶部; up:向 … http://www.hackdig.com/02/hack-57713.htm jobs at christiana hospital in de

PlaidCTF

Category:How to use the archinfo.ArchARM function in archinfo Snyk

Tags:Rebased_addr

Rebased_addr

angr学习笔记 violet-233の博客

WebbMessage ID: [email protected] (mailing list archive)State: New, archived: Headers: show Webb1 maj 2024 · .rebased_addr是它在全局地址空间的地址。这是打印输出显示的内容。.linked_addr是相对于二进制的预链接基址的地址。 这是例如readelf(1)获取到的地址, …

Rebased_addr

Did you know?

Webbdef prepare_function_symbol (self, symbol_name, basic_addr = None): """ Prepare the address space with the data necessary to perform relocations pointing to the given symbol Returns a 2-tuple. The first item is the address of the function code, the second is the address of the relocation target. """ if basic_addr is None: basic_addr = self. project. … Webb11 apr. 2024 · cn-sec 中文网 . 聚合网络安全,存储安全技术文章,融合安全最新讯息

Webbdef hook (self, addr, hook = None, length = 0, kwargs = None, replace = False): """ Hook a section of code with a custom function. This is used internally to provide symbolic … Webb21 sep. 2024 · block (addr) 提取给定地址的基本块,返回一个块对象。 需要注意的是Angr分析程序的单元是基本。 bitvector 寄存器使用位向量来描述 基本块 属性 instructions 对应基本块的指令的个数。 instructions_addrs 基本块每个 capstone capstone block对象 vex 方法 pp () 漂亮地输出对象基本块的汇编代码。 state project 只是给出程序最初镜像 …

Webb# 1.将指令地址addr转为cfg节点对象target_node target_node = cfg.model.get_any_node (addr,anyaddr=True) # 2.遍历函数管理器,看基本块地址是否在函数内,若在,则说明指 …

WebbRe: [edk2-buildtools] [edk2] Rebasing an FV in FDF Brought to you by: jljusten, laurie0131, michaelkrau, tianocore Summary Files Reviews Support Mailing Lists Code

Webb19 nov. 2024 · simulation = project.factory.simgr (initial_state) auto_load_libs :表是否载入依赖库的函数,libc等,如果不载入,返回的值是不可约束的,但是载入可能会路径爆 … insulated waterproof logger bootsWebbRe: [edk2-buildtools] [edk2] Rebasing an FV in FDF Brought to you by: jljusten, laurie0131, michaelkrau, tianocore Summary Files Reviews Support Wiki Mailing Lists insulated waterproof outdoor cat houseWebb17 nov. 2024 · 使用angrutils生成控制流图出错的解决过程. 在使用angrutils生成控制流图时出错,它先报FileNotFoundError: [Errno 2] No such file or directory: ‘dot’ : ‘dot’,然后再 … jobs at christmas islandWebbExample #1. def process_successors(self, successors, **kwargs): state = self.state # we have at this point entered the next step so we need to check the previous jumpkind if not … jobs at christus spohn shorelineWebb24 sep. 2024 · Stack Overflow Public questions & answers; Stack Overflow for Teams Where developers & technologists share private knowledge with coworkers; Talent Build … jobs at cincinnati bellWebbStub function. Should be overridden by backends that can provide initializer functions that ought to be run before execution reaches the entry point. Addresses should be rebased. … insulated waterproof precision work glovesWebb17 dec. 2024 · angr-utils. Angr-utils is a collection of utilities for angr binary analysis framework.. Note. Visualisation for various graphs (currently supported: CFG, CG; … insulated waterproof large box